0

凡例を表示するために (jquery flot テキストから) canvasText で jquery flot を使用しています。 「ー」など…

「摂氏温度」を表示しようとすると、「摂氏温度」しか表示されません...

標準のASCII文字がすべて含まれている宣言(CanvasTextFunctions.letters)があることがわかりますが、他の文字を追加する方法がわかりません...

前もって感謝します...

4

1 に答える 1

1

最後に、テーブルに新しい文字を追加する方法を理解しました。これはその一部です。

    'º': { width: 12, points: [[8,21],[10,19],[10,17],[9,15],[7,14],[5,14],[3,16],[3,18],[4,20],[6,21],[8,21],[10,20]] },
    'á': { width: 19, points: [[9,19],[15,24],[-1,-1],[15,14],[15,0],[-1,-1],[15,11],[13,13],[11,14],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3]] },
    'à': { width: 19, points: [[9,19],[3,24],[-1,-1],[15,14],[15,0],[-1,-1],[15,11],[13,13],[11,14],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3]] },
    'é': { width: 18, points: [[9,19],[15,24],[-1,-1],[3,8],[15,8],[15,10],[14,12],[13,13],[11,14],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3]] },
    'è': { width: 18, points: [[9,19],[3,24],[-1,-1],[3,8],[15,8],[15,10],[14,12],[13,13],[11,14],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3]] },
    'ó': { width: 19, points: [[9,19],[15,24],[-1,-1],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3],[16,6],[16,8],[15,11],[13,13],[11,14],[8,14]] },
    'ò': { width: 19, points: [[9,19],[3,24],[-1,-1],[8,14],[6,13],[4,11],[3,8],[3,6],[4,3],[6,1],[8,0],[11,0],[13,1],[15,3],[16,6],[16,8],[15,11],[13,13],[11,14],[8,14]] },
    'ú': { width: 19, points: [[9,18],[15,23],[-1,-1],[4,14],[4,4],[5,1],[7,0],[10,0],[12,1],[15,4],[-1,-1],[15,14],[15,0]] },
    'ù': { width: 19, points: [[9,18],[3,23],[-1,-1],[4,14],[4,4],[5,1],[7,0],[10,0],[12,1],[15,4],[-1,-1],[15,14],[15,0]] },
    'ì': { width: 10, points: [[8,17],[3,23],[-1,-1],[5,14],[5,0]] },
    'í': { width: 10, points: [[3,17],[8,23],[-1,-1],[4,14],[4,0]] }
于 2013-10-25T07:44:21.867 に答える